What are the key features of home automation systems?
Home automation systems offer a range of features designed to enhance convenience, security, and energy efficiency in residential settings. Key features include smart lighting control, remote access and monitoring, energy management, security integration, and voice control compatibility.
Smart lighting control
Smart lighting control allows homeowners to manage their lighting systems remotely or through automated schedules. Users can adjust brightness, color, and even set scenes for different activities, enhancing both ambiance and energy efficiency.
Consider systems that integrate with existing fixtures or offer smart bulbs that can be easily installed. Look for options that allow for dimming and color changes to suit various moods or times of day.
Remote access and monitoring
Remote access and monitoring enable users to control their home automation systems from anywhere using a smartphone or tablet. This feature provides peace of mind, allowing homeowners to check on their property and make adjustments while away.
Choose systems that offer secure mobile apps with user-friendly interfaces. Ensure that the system supports notifications for alerts, such as when doors are opened or when unusual activity is detected.
Energy management
Energy management features help homeowners monitor and reduce energy consumption, leading to cost savings. These systems can track usage patterns and suggest ways to optimize energy use, such as scheduling devices to run during off-peak hours.
Look for systems that provide real-time data on energy consumption and allow for automated adjustments based on user preferences. This can include smart thermostats that learn your habits and adjust heating or cooling accordingly.
Security and surveillance integration
Security and surveillance integration connects cameras, alarms, and sensors to the home automation system, enhancing overall safety. Homeowners can receive alerts and view live feeds from their devices, ensuring they are always aware of their home’s security status.
Consider systems that offer cloud storage for video footage and easy access to recordings. Ensure that the security features comply with local regulations regarding surveillance and privacy.
Voice control compatibility
Voice control compatibility allows users to operate their home automation systems using voice commands through devices like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ant. This feature adds convenience and accessibility, particularly for individuals with mobility challenges.
When selecting a system, ensure it supports multiple voice assistants and can integrate with other smart devices in your home. Check for responsiveness and accuracy to ensure a seamless user experience.
How do home automation systems enhance security in India?
Home automation systems significantly enhance security in India by integrating various smart devices that monitor and control access to your home. These systems provide real-time data and alerts, allowing homeowners to respond quickly to potential threats.
Real-time alerts and notifications
Real-time alerts and notifications are crucial features of home automation systems. They inform homeowners immediately about unusual activities, such as unauthorized access or environmental hazards like smoke or water leaks. Notifications can be sent via smartphone apps, ensuring that users are always connected to their home security.
For effective security, consider setting up alerts for specific events, such as when doors are opened or when motion is detected in restricted areas. This proactive approach allows for timely responses, potentially preventing theft or damage.
Smart locks and access control
Smart locks provide enhanced access control by allowing homeowners to manage entry points remotely. These locks can be programmed to grant access to family members or trusted visitors while denying entry to others. Many smart locks also offer features like temporary access codes, which can be useful for service personnel.
When choosing smart locks, look for options that integrate with your home automation system and offer robust encryption. This ensures that your access control remains secure against hacking attempts.
Video doorbells and cameras
Video doorbells and security cameras are essential components of a comprehensive home security system. They allow homeowners to see and communicate with visitors remotely, enhancing safety by verifying identities before granting access. Many systems also offer cloud storage for recorded footage, which can be crucial for evidence in case of incidents.
When selecting video doorbells and cameras, consider features like night vision, motion detection, and two-way audio. These functionalities improve overall security and provide peace of mind, especially in urban areas where crime rates may be higher.
What are the benefits of energy management in home automation?
Energy management in home automation systems offers significant advantages, including reduced utility costs and improved efficiency. By optimizing energy use, homeowners can lower their bills while contributing to environmental sustainability.
Reduced energy consumption
Home automation systems can significantly lower energy consumption by monitoring and controlling usage patterns. Smart devices can identify when appliances are not in use and turn them off automatically, leading to savings of up to 30% on energy bills.
For example, smart thermostats adjust heating and cooling based on occupancy, ensuring that energy is not wasted when no one is home. This not only conserves energy but also enhances comfort and reduces wear on HVAC systems.
Automated scheduling for appliances
Automated scheduling allows homeowners to run appliances during off-peak hours when energy rates are lower. This feature can be particularly beneficial for washing machines, dishwashers, and electric vehicle chargers.
By programming these devices to operate at night or during weekends, users can take advantage of lower electricity rates, potentially saving hundreds of dollars annually. Many systems also provide reminders or alerts to optimize usage further.
Integration with renewable energy sources
Home automation systems can seamlessly integrate with renewable energy sources such as solar panels. This integration allows homeowners to maximize the use of generated energy, reducing reliance on the grid and lowering overall energy costs.
For instance, systems can be programmed to run high-energy appliances when solar production is at its peak, ensuring that the energy generated is used efficiently. This not only saves money but also promotes a sustainable lifestyle by utilizing clean energy sources.
Which devices are commonly used in home automation systems?
Home automation systems typically include a variety of devices that enhance convenience, security, and energy efficiency. Common devices include smart thermostats, smart speakers, and smart plugs and switches, each serving distinct functions within a connected home environment.
Smart thermostats
Smart thermostats allow homeowners to control their heating and cooling systems remotely, often through a mobile app. These devices can learn user preferences and adjust settings automatically, leading to energy savings of around 10-15% on heating and cooling bills.
When selecting a smart thermostat, consider compatibility with your HVAC system and whether it supports features like geofencing, which adjusts the temperature based on your location. Popular models include the Nest Learning Thermostat and the Ecobee SmartThermostat.
Smart speakers
Smart speakers serve as central hubs for controlling various smart home devices through voice commands. They can play music, provide weather updates, and integrate with other smart devices for seamless automation.
When choosing a smart speaker, look for compatibility with your existing devices and ecosystems, such as Amazon Alexa, Google Assistant, or Apple HomeKit. Popular options include the Amazon Echo and Google Nest Audio, which offer robust features and voice recognition capabilities.
Smart plugs and switches
Smart plugs and switches enable users to control electrical devices remotely, turning them on or off via a smartphone app or voice command. They can help manage energy consumption by scheduling devices to operate only when needed.
When selecting smart plugs or switches, ensure they are compatible with your home’s electrical system and consider features like energy monitoring. Brands like TP-Link and Wemo offer reliable options that integrate well with various smart home ecosystems.
How to choose the right home automation system for your needs?
Choosing the right home automation system involves assessing your current devices, ease of use, and future needs. Start by identifying what you want to automate and ensure the system is compatible with your existing technology.
Assessing compatibility with existing devices
Compatibility is crucial when selecting a home automation system. Check if the system can integrate with your current devices, such as smart bulbs, thermostats, and security cameras. Most systems support popular brands, but always verify specific models.
Look for systems that use common protocols like Zigbee, Z-Wave, or Wi-Fi, as these are more likely to work with a wide range of devices. A compatibility checklist can help ensure all your devices will function seamlessly together.
Evaluating user interface and ease of use
The user interface should be intuitive and easy to navigate. A complicated interface can lead to frustration and decreased usage. Opt for systems that offer mobile apps with clear layouts and straightforward controls.
Consider systems that provide voice control options and compatibility with virtual ass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ant. This can enhance convenience and accessibility, making it easier to manage your home automation.
Considering scalability and future upgrades
Scalability is essential for adapting your home automation system as your needs change. Choose a system that allows you to add new devices and features over time without requiring a complete overhaul.
Research systems that offer regular software updates and support for new technologies. This ensures your investment remains relevant and functional as advancements in home automation continue to evolve.
What are the costs associated with home automation systems in India?
The costs of home automation systems in India can vary significantly based on the complexity and scale of the installation. Generally, homeowners can expect to invest anywhere from INR 20,000 to several lakhs, depending on the features and devices chosen.
Initial setup costs
Initial setup costs for home automation systems typically include the price of devices, installation fees, and any necessary infrastructure upgrades. Basic systems may start around INR 20,000, while more advanced setups with multiple smart devices can exceed INR 1,00,000.
When planning your budget, consider the types of devices you want to include, such as smart lighting, security cameras, or climate control systems. Each device comes with its own price range, and installation costs can add an additional 10-20% to your total expenses.
To avoid overspending, prioritize essential features first and gradually expand your system. Research various brands and compare prices to find the best deals, and look for bundled offers that can reduce overall costs.
